Output e35d3db4d49100999a259f5c017cf4fe94d34bfafcb89bda125d3653bf0ec2d9:0

value
691569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8157403343d24a6729883298c29a16b7eef7dc5c OP_EQUAL
address
3DUucad5ZcHEJBDJAYcmNHSrEVk5nUrq1N
transaction
e35d3db4d49100999a259f5c017cf4fe94d34bfafcb89bda125d3653bf0ec2d9